Connecting the headset to 2 Android smartphones (multipoint connection)
Usually, when you connect the headset to a smartphone, both the music playback function and the phone call function
are connected simultaneously.
To make a multipoint connection using 2 smartphones to use one for listening to music and the other for making phone
calls, set up to connect to only one function by operating the smartphone.
Pair the headset with both smartphones in advance.
1
Operate one of the smartphones to establish a Bluetooth connection with the headset.
2
Operate the smartphone connected to the headset, uncheck either [Call audio] (HFP) or [Media audio]
(A2DP).
Operation example: For connecting only through media audio (A2DP)
Touch [Settings] - [Device connection] - [Bluetooth] - the setting icon next to [Float Run].
On the [Paired devices] screen, uncheck [Call audio].
3
Operate the smartphone to terminate the Bluetooth connection.
4
Operate the other smartphone to establish a Bluetooth connection with the headset.
5
In the same way as in step
, uncheck the function that you did not uncheck in step .
6
Operate the first smartphone to establish a Bluetooth connection with the headset.
Both smartphones are connected to the headset with only one function enabled.

Sony Float Run Specifications

General IconGeneral
TypeOpen-ear
ConnectivityBluetooth
Driver Size16 mm
Weight33 g
Frequency Response20 Hz - 20, 000 Hz
Bluetooth Version5.0
Battery LifeUp to 10 hours
Water ResistanceIPX4
Charging TimeApprox. 3 hours
Wireless Range10m
